Postmortem timeline — Quillbase serverless cold starts. 09:02 release 4.18 deployed. 09:10 p95 latency tripled; cold starts up due to larger bundle and VPC attach. 09:25 rolled back. 09:40 confirmed recovery. Fix: trim dependencies, enable provisioned warm pool before next release. No data loss. Rollback artifact verified; its token is listed below.

trace token, fafog-kageg: htk4_98e6

Subject: Handover — Waveform Preview release 2.4

Hi Daliya,

Taking over from me this sprint: the audio waveform preview in SoundLoft now renders server-side via the Cresten pipeline. Please review the downsampling commit carefully — peak detection changed and the snapshot tests were regenerated. Build artifacts must be signed before the canary push on Thursday. For verification during review, the current release key follows below.

rollout seal: bky4_x7Gc

# Break-Glass: Catalog Cache Invalidation

Scope: the Pinrow product catalog at Veldstone Retail. If stale prices persist after a purge and the Hollowmere invalidation queue is wedged, use break-glass to flush the edge tier directly. Contractors: get verbal sign-off from the catalog lead first. Steps: open the Hollowmere admin shell, select emergency-flush, confirm the tenant, and run it once — repeated flushes thrash the origin. Access is logged and expires after 20 minutes. Unseal the admin shell with the passphrase below.

recovery phrase for kahop-tajog: istix-casvan